617 Commits

Author SHA1 Message Date
bol-van
729ded0c61 nfqws: conntrack workaround TTL=1 2025-05-09 11:17:21 +03:00
bol-van
691a501b0d nfqws,tpws: do most checks before daemonize 2025-05-09 10:32:19 +03:00
bol-van
e62fb2f0f4 nfqws: simplify conntrack workaround 2025-05-08 19:46:35 +03:00
bol-van
603265dac2 nfqws: do not realloc hostname in ipcache if it's the same 2025-05-08 13:45:28 +03:00
bol-van
ed0bb4c106 tpws: ipcache socks hostname 2025-05-08 13:42:24 +03:00
bol-van
6eae2b0e71 doc works 2025-05-08 12:23:51 +03:00
bol-van
c59771f744 doc works 2025-05-08 12:20:55 +03:00
bol-van
dd23d6f3f4 doc works 2025-05-08 12:08:38 +03:00
bol-van
92dc012f08 doc works 2025-05-08 12:01:04 +03:00
bol-van
9bcefde37a doc works 2025-05-08 11:45:50 +03:00
bol-van
d2f7a53927 nfqws: --ctrack-disable 2025-05-08 09:00:20 +03:00
bol-van
f1dd351854 nfqws: --ctrack-disable 2025-05-08 08:54:05 +03:00
bol-van
5c63cb43e7 readme: update vps section 2025-05-06 09:58:03 +03:00
bol-van
7f24f82002 readme: update vps section 2025-05-06 09:51:53 +03:00
bol-van
b0c7af789a init: remove autohostlist touch, not needed anymore 2025-05-04 22:02:36 +03:00
bol-van
a426ea6dad nfqws,tpws: check list files accessibility after all params are parsed 2025-05-04 22:01:00 +03:00
bol-van
bda4226162 init: create autohostlist file if not exists 2025-05-04 21:47:26 +03:00
bol-van
dc1dc5c876 drop time exceeded icmp for nfqws-related connections 2025-05-04 18:21:43 +03:00
bol-van
3ca682e25a drop time exceeded icmp for nfqws-related connections 2025-05-04 18:15:33 +03:00
bol-van
9629ce5cb7 tpws: ipcache 2025-05-04 10:57:23 +03:00
bol-van
c626d88f54 nfqws: minor changes 2025-05-04 10:42:27 +03:00
bol-van
c91ddf4a54 nfqws: do not use interface name for ip->hostname 2025-05-03 22:06:14 +03:00
bol-van
6f1286b5b9 nfqws: fix mem leak 2025-05-03 21:59:43 +03:00
bol-van
c96bc62d3b nfqws: ip->hostname cache 2025-05-03 20:25:53 +03:00
bol-van
8432388b37 nfqws: debug autottl cache lifetime 2025-05-03 15:15:26 +03:00
bol-van
7efa83e61e init.d: remove --ipset prohibition 2025-05-03 13:03:33 +03:00
bol-van
abe91a4bfa nfqws: ipcache destroy in cleanup_params 2025-05-03 12:50:53 +03:00
bol-van
43173e6396 nfqws: return autottl path len check 2025-05-03 12:28:49 +03:00
bol-van
5cc888cd2c nfqws: autottl cache, --dup-autottl, --orig-autottl 2025-05-03 12:11:16 +03:00
bol-van
5b625fa709 update nftables.txt,iptables.txt 2025-05-03 10:54:59 +03:00
bol-van
0a8135b2de update config defaults 2025-05-03 10:52:20 +03:00
bol-van
d21175b4a3 nfqws: prepare for +- autottl 2025-04-29 17:45:34 +03:00
bol-van
68a538daed nfqws: conntrack: do not reset entry on dup SA 2025-04-29 16:31:37 +03:00
bol-van
d2c9ff50cd nfqws: copy DF ip flag 2025-04-29 13:36:05 +03:00
bol-van
50539d6cbf nfqws: windows fixes for recent changes 2025-04-29 12:25:23 +03:00
bol-van
8b5dfcfae1 nfqws: dup,orig_mod 2025-04-26 19:48:35 +03:00
bol-van
ccc60b5f07 init.d: fix missing - sign in 50-nfqws-ipset 2025-04-22 19:28:14 +03:00
bol-van
7f94f42b1d init.d: fix local var name 2025-04-22 19:07:26 +03:00
bol-van
1c1f259b39 init.d: improve nfqws ipset example 2025-04-22 19:03:18 +03:00
bol-van
6ef6c8ee5a nfqws: do not use overlapping memcmp 2025-04-21 15:54:06 +03:00
bol-van
581badfb73 nfqws: --dpi-desync-fake-tls=! 2025-04-21 14:52:51 +03:00
bol-van
8fce75daa4 hardware offload: be closer to fw4 in interface names 2025-04-20 11:26:07 +03:00
bol-van
c1e2e56576 hardware offload: be closer to fw4 in interface names 2025-04-20 11:24:55 +03:00
bol-van
e16ec69922 nfqws: fix unitialized use of host buffer (udp) 2025-04-20 08:49:50 +03:00
bol-van
63256a142f nfqws: fix unitialized use of host buffer 2025-04-19 19:59:42 +03:00
bol-van
4a9a8bd48e typo 2025-04-19 19:41:40 +03:00
bol-van
b996abd5ce nfqws,tpws: use tls record length in TLSDebug 2025-04-14 12:18:07 +03:00
bol-van
12461de3b0 nfqws,tpws: optimize tls debug, show quic 2025-04-14 11:21:16 +03:00
bol-van
7dab497b57 nfqws,tpws: optimize tls debug, show quic 2025-04-14 11:20:20 +03:00
bol-van
41dbba1c4c nfqws,tpws: debug alpn and ech 2025-04-13 18:07:46 +03:00